Abstract

It is understood that school photography goes beyond mere mimesis of reality, its production and uses carry a complexity of visual discourses and social functions that insert it in the field of representations and visualities. Therefore, it is a potential cultural artifact for historiographic problematization. Given such premises about the portrait produced in and for the school, the present paper aims to understand how the photographic representation of some school spaces in Ponta Grossa city was given by the Photo Bianchi studio's lens during its first photographers generation, comprehended between 1913-1943. The research uses the studio negative plates available at the Foto Bianchi Fund, located at the Paraná Memory House (Ponta Grossa), and some paper photographs available at the Campos Gerais Museum collection (Ponta Grossa). In addition, in order to contribute and support the analysis, a set of secondary sources are fundamental to the discussions: Paraná’s Public Instruction Regulation (1890), Paraná’s State Teaching Code (1917), Practical Handbook of Photographia (1925) and The Educational Bases of the Normal School (1927). Along with the sources of the period, the interviews of Rauly Bianchi (1982) and Raul Bianchi (2001) are essential to the problematic of some questions about the studio and its trajectory. Given this, the research is inserted in the History of Representations field, having as references Sandra Pesavento (2009), Roger Chartier (2010) and José Martins (2009). Also, it has the theoretical support of studies by Peter Burke and Boris Kossoy (2009; 2014) about the photography’s use as a historiographical document, Ulpiano Meneses (2003; 2005; 2012) and Raimundo Martins (2006) with their discussions about the Visual History and Visual Culture, André Rouillé (2009) and François Soulages (2005) regarding photographic statute and photographicity, Ana Maria Mauad (1996), Carvalho e Lima (1997) and Ivo Canabarro (2015) regarding a critical-analytical methodology against photographic documents. Finally, to support the school portrait’s notion, the researches of Rachel Abdala (2013) and Alik Wunder (2008) are used.
